Difference between economy tyre and sport tyre?

In summary: Economy tyres are either really cheap tyres (if you're not too fussed about performance or safety) or tyres which are designed to give minimal rolling resistance and increase fuel economy. Sport tyres are designed to offer more in the way of grip and traction. Road tires are used on the road.

  • #4


What do you mean by speed? Pure top speed? Broadly weight and tyres don't affect top speed. Thats power and aero.

If you mean lap time. Probably weight is the primary killer of lap time, but tyres are equal or a very very close second.

Reducing weight will improve the performance and economy of the car. Soft tires will assist in turns and acceleration but fuel economy will suffer. Hard tires last longer and roll easier but you will lose acceleration and cornering.
